7 Technical data
Table 8: Technical data
Processor Zync Ultrascale+, 64 bit, 4 × ARM A53
RAM 2 GByte DRAM
Extensions COREX-C: None
Communication interfaces RJ45
• 3 × Ethernet connection (10 MB, 100 MB, 1 GB)
USB
• 1 × USB host, TYPE C (USB2.0), maximum cable length of 3 m
SD card Slot for microSD card
Battery CR1025
Weight 314 g
Dimensions Refer to ⮫ Chapter 10.1 Housing dimensions on page 17

NOTICE
Electronic damage due to polarity reversal or due to a nominal
current that is too low
The power supply unit has to be able to provide the quadruple
nominal current of the maximum current consumption to ensure a
reliable triggering in case of a failure.
